Description

This milestone, likely from the 19th century, is located to the northeast of High Annat Walls along the B6277 road in Alston Moor. It stands approximately 2½ feet high and is made from a single stone. The milestone features two angled front faces and an angled top. It is painted white, with carved sans-serif lettering highlighted in black. The inscriptions read: "ASHGILLHEAD 9½" at the top, "ALSTON 1" on the left, and "MIDDLETON 21" on the right.
